Changeset 503
- Timestamp:
- 06/12/06 15:57:38
- Files:
-
- trunk/README (modified) (1 diff)
- trunk/configure.ac (modified) (7 diffs)
- trunk/libtinymail-camel/tny-msg-mime-part.c (modified) (1 diff)
- trunk/libtinymail-camel/tny-store-account.c (modified) (1 diff)
- trunk/libtinymailui-gtk/tny-save-strategy.c (modified) (1 diff)
- trunk/po/Makefile.in.in (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/README
r402 r503 3 3 Required packages on a Ubuntu Breezy (for building from subversion repository) 4 4 gnome-devel, subversion, firefox-dev, libcamel1.2-dev, libnm-glib-0-dev, automake-1.7 5 6 Required packages on a Fedora Core 4 & 5 (for building from subversion repository) subversion, gnome-common, evolution-data-server-devel, NetworkManager-devel, NetworkManager-glib, gnome-keyring-devel, automake-1.7. Use --with-html-component=none to disable building any HTML component trunk/configure.ac
r381 r503 120 120 121 121 dnl ### libtinymail, the abstraction library ## 122 PKG_CHECK_MODULES(LIBTINYMAIL, glib-2.0 >= 2. 8gobject-2.0)122 PKG_CHECK_MODULES(LIBTINYMAIL, glib-2.0 >= 2.6 gobject-2.0) 123 123 AC_SUBST(LIBTINYMAIL_CFLAGS) 124 124 AC_SUBST(LIBTINYMAIL_LIBS) 125 125 126 126 dnl ### libtinymailui, the ui abstraction library ## 127 PKG_CHECK_MODULES(LIBTINYMAILUI, glib-2.0 >= 2. 8gobject-2.0)127 PKG_CHECK_MODULES(LIBTINYMAILUI, glib-2.0 >= 2.6 gobject-2.0) 128 128 AC_SUBST(LIBTINYMAILUI_CFLAGS) 129 129 AC_SUBST(LIBTINYMAILUI_LIBS) 130 130 131 131 dnl ### libtinymail-camel, a camel implementation of libtinymail ## 132 PKG_CHECK_MODULES(LIBTINYMAIL_CAMEL, glib-2.0 >= 2. 8gobject-2.0 camel-1.2 camel-provider-1.2)132 PKG_CHECK_MODULES(LIBTINYMAIL_CAMEL, glib-2.0 >= 2.6 gobject-2.0 camel-1.2 camel-provider-1.2) 133 133 AC_SUBST(LIBTINYMAIL_CAMEL_CFLAGS) 134 134 AC_SUBST(LIBTINYMAIL_CAMEL_LIBS) … … 136 136 dnl ### libtinymail-gnomevfs, a tnystreamiface for gnome-vfs ## 137 137 if test x$build_gnome = xtrue; then 138 extragtkpkgs= libgnomeui-2.0139 extratnypkgs= gnome-vfs-2.0140 PKG_CHECK_MODULES(LIBTINYMAIL_GNOMEVFS, glib-2.0 >= 2. 8gobject-2.0 gnome-vfs-2.0)138 extragtkpkgs="libgnomeui-2.0 gnome-keyring-1" 139 extratnypkgs="gnome-vfs-2.0" 140 PKG_CHECK_MODULES(LIBTINYMAIL_GNOMEVFS, glib-2.0 >= 2.6 gobject-2.0 gnome-vfs-2.0) 141 141 else 142 142 LIBTINYMAIL_GNOMEVFS_CFLAGS= … … 149 149 150 150 dnl ### libtinymailui-gtk, a gtk+ implementation of libtinymail-ui ## 151 PKG_CHECK_MODULES(LIBTINYMAILUI_GTK, glib-2.0 >= 2. 8gobject-2.0 $extragtkpkgs gtk+-2.0)151 PKG_CHECK_MODULES(LIBTINYMAILUI_GTK, glib-2.0 >= 2.6 gobject-2.0 $extragtkpkgs gtk+-2.0) 152 152 AC_SUBST(LIBTINYMAILUI_GTK_CFLAGS) 153 153 AC_SUBST(LIBTINYMAILUI_GTK_LIBS) … … 157 157 extraplatpkgs="firefox-nspr firefox-nss firefox-xpcom firefox-gtkmozembed" 158 158 extratnypkgs="$extratnypkgs $extraplatpkgs" 159 PKG_CHECK_MODULES(LIBTINYMAILUI_MOZEMBED, $extraplatpkgs glib-2.0 >= 2. 8gobject-2.0 gtk+-2.0 $extragtkpkgs)159 PKG_CHECK_MODULES(LIBTINYMAILUI_MOZEMBED, $extraplatpkgs glib-2.0 >= 2.6 gobject-2.0 gtk+-2.0 $extragtkpkgs) 160 160 else 161 161 LIBTINYMAILUI_MOZEMBED_CFLAGS= … … 165 165 dnl ### libtinymail-gnome-desktop, a GNOME platform library implementation ## 166 166 if test x$PLATFORMDIR = xlibtinymail-gnome-desktop; then 167 PKG_CHECK_MODULES(LIBTINYMAIL_GNOME_DESKTOP, $extraplatpkgs libnm_glib glib-2.0 >= 2.8 gobject-2.0 libgnomeui-2.0 gtk+-2.0)167 PKG_CHECK_MODULES(LIBTINYMAIL_GNOME_DESKTOP, gconf-2.0 $extraplatpkgs libnm_glib glib-2.0 >= 2.6 gobject-2.0 gtk+-2.0 $extragtkpkgs) 168 168 else 169 169 LIBTINYMAIL_GNOME_DESKTOP_CFLAGS= … … 178 178 dnl ### libtinymail-test, a library for testing purposes ## 179 179 if test x$build_unittests = xtrue; then 180 PKG_CHECK_MODULES(LIBTINYMAIL_TEST, gunit gtk+-2.0 glib-2.0 >= 2. 8gobject-2.0 camel-1.2 camel-provider-1.2 $extratnypkgs)180 PKG_CHECK_MODULES(LIBTINYMAIL_TEST, gunit gtk+-2.0 glib-2.0 >= 2.6 gobject-2.0 camel-1.2 camel-provider-1.2 $extratnypkgs) 181 181 else 182 182 LIBTINYMAIL_TEST_CFLAGS= … … 188 188 dnl ### tinymail, the demo-ui ## 189 189 dnl Try to remove the gtk+ and gconf dependency by refactoring to libraries 190 PKG_CHECK_MODULES(TINYMAIL, glib-2.0 >= 2. 8gobject-2.0 gconf-2.0 gtk+-2.0 $extratnypkgs)190 PKG_CHECK_MODULES(TINYMAIL, glib-2.0 >= 2.6 gobject-2.0 gconf-2.0 gtk+-2.0 $extratnypkgs) 191 191 AC_SUBST(TINYMAIL_CFLAGS) 192 192 AC_SUBST(TINYMAIL_LIBS) trunk/libtinymail-camel/tny-msg-mime-part.c
r483 r503 49 49 #include <camel/camel-mime-filter-charset.h> 50 50 #include <camel/camel-mime-filter-windows.h> 51 #include <camel/camel-mime-filter-pgp.h>52 51 53 52 trunk/libtinymail-camel/tny-store-account.c
r490 r503 34 34 #include <camel/camel-session.h> 35 35 #include <camel/camel-store.h> 36 37 #ifndef CAMEL_FOLDER_TYPE_SENT 38 #define CAMEL_FOLDER_TYPE_SENT (5 << 10) 39 #endif 36 40 37 41 trunk/libtinymailui-gtk/tny-save-strategy.c
r380 r503 106 106 gboolean destr=FALSE; 107 107 108 gtk_file_chooser_set_do_overwrite_confirmation109 (GTK_FILE_CHOOSER (dialog), TRUE); 108 /* gtk_file_chooser_set_do_overwrite_confirmation 109 (GTK_FILE_CHOOSER (dialog), TRUE); */ 110 110 111 111 gtk_file_chooser_set_current_folder trunk/po/Makefile.in.in
r379 r503 79 79 .po.gmo: 80 80 file=$(srcdir)/`echo $* | sed 's,.*/,,'`.gmo \ 81 && rm -f $$file && $(GMSGFMT) - c -o $$file $<81 && rm -f $$file && $(GMSGFMT) -o $$file $< 82 82 83 83 .po.cat: … … 94 94 $(XGETTEXT) --default-domain=$(GETTEXT_PACKAGE) --directory=$(top_srcdir) \ 95 95 --add-comments --keyword=_ --keyword=N_ \ 96 --flag=g_strdup_printf:1:c-format \97 --flag=g_string_printf:2:c-format \98 --flag=g_string_append_printf:2:c-format \99 --flag=g_error_new:3:c-format \100 --flag=g_set_error:4:c-format \101 --flag=g_markup_printf_escaped:1:c-format \102 --flag=g_log:3:c-format \103 --flag=g_print:1:c-format \104 --flag=g_printerr:1:c-format \105 --flag=g_printf:1:c-format \106 --flag=g_fprintf:2:c-format \107 --flag=g_sprintf:2:c-format \108 --flag=g_snprintf:3:c-format \109 --flag=g_scanner_error:2:c-format \110 --flag=g_scanner_warn:2:c-format \111 96 --files-from=$(srcdir)/POTFILES.in \ 112 97 && test ! -f $(GETTEXT_PACKAGE).po \
